Arabian Coffee
5.3

Arabian Coffee

'Coffea arábiga' was sponsored as a propaganda documentary to show how to sow coffee around Havana. In fact, Guillén Landrián made a film critical of Castro, exhibited but banned as soon as the coffee plan collapsed.

Coffee: Between Reality and Imagination
0.0

Coffee: Between Reality and Imagination

A cinematic collaboration between young Israeli and Palestinian filmmakers, who together created a series of short films. Coffee takes part in our cultural identity, it is shared by all individuals in terms of our daily routine and pastes different people together, no matter who they are. Includes two documentaries and two fiction films made by Palestinian filmmakers, and four fiction films made by Israeli filmmakers. Each of the films gives a personal and courageous point of view on the reality in which we live in.
